[[http://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/OTC_VIBVU OTC_VIBVU]] Reversibly catalyzes the transfer of the carbamoyl group from carbamoyl phosphate (CP) to the N(epsilon) atom of ornithine (ORN) to produce L-citrulline, which is a substrate for argininosuccinate synthetase, the enzyme involved in the final step in arginine biosynthesis (By similarity).

2.9 Angstrom Crystal Structure of Ornithine Carbamoyltransferase (ArgF) from Vibrio vulnificus

3upd, resolution 2.91Å
